    Notes: Abstract The purpose of our research is to obtain an understanding of the binding mechanism and its correlations in terms of chemical structure and the potentiactive drug activity. The interaction of 5-fluorouracil (5-fluorouracil is used as an anticancer drug) with sodium poly-α,L-glutamate in aqueous solution was studied with a spectral method and viscosity measurement. From the binding data, the molar change in enthalpy, entropy and the number of binding sites on the polymer were calculated. It is very interesting that the value ofΔH0 of the binding of 5-fluorouracil with sodium poly-α,L-glutamate is smaller than that of 5-trifluoromethyluracil (although 5-trifluoromethyluracil is not used as an anticancer drug, the compound has a similar structure to 5-fluorouracil).

    Notes: Summary Ultrasonographic examination was performed in 13 preterm, 10 normal term and 3 term brain-damaged infants to evaluate changes of the ventricular width with the head position. The lower side of the frontal horn was narrowed and the upper side dilated in all preterm and brain-damaged infants. These changes of the ventricular width may be due to gravity and soft brain. Therefore, it is very important to consider the transformation of the lateral ventricles with the head position when asymmetry of the lateral ventricle is identified in infants showing prematurity or brain damage.
